African Energy Reporting typically involves gathering, analyzing, and disseminating information related to the energy sector in Africa. This encompasses various aspects such as:
1. Energy production and consumption trends
2. Renewable energy developments (solar, wind, hydro)
3. Fossil fuel exploration and extraction
4. Energy policy and regulatory updates
5. Infrastructure development (power plants, transmission lines)
African Energy Reporting can be done through various media channels, including news articles, research reports, and industry publications. It aims to inform stakeholders, including investors, policymakers, and the general public, about the latest developments and trends in Africa’s energy landscape.
